Hockey is offered in different variations to students depending on their year level.
Years 1–2 students have one lunchtime practice a week during Terms 2 and 3 with Preparatory School Hockey Captains.
Year 3–8 students have one practice and play one afterschool game every week. Games are during term time and school holidays.
Mini Sticks (Years 3 and 4) play their games on a Friday afternoon/evening and have one practice per week.
Kiwi Sticks (Year 5 and 6) and Kwik Sticks (Year 7 and 8) have one practice, one core sport practice (during school time) and play one weekend game per week. The Years 7 and 8 competition is 7 aside.
Games are held at various venues around Christchurch.
The uniform is a St Andrew's College hockey shirt, blue shorts and long blue socks which can be purchased from the College Shop. A mouth guard and shin pads are compulsory. Hockey shirts are provided by the school.
